Andrew summered at the firm in 2025. He recently graduated from the Lincoln Alexander School of Law. During law school, Andrew was actively involved in equity and inclusion initiatives. He served on the executive of Lincoln OUTLaws, a student organization dedicated to fostering a positive and inclusive environment for 2SLGBTQIA+ students. He also volunteered with The 519 Legal Clinic through Pro Bono Students Canada, supporting vulnerable communities by helping deliver accessible legal education. Prior to law school, Andrew earned his Chartered Professional Accountant designation and spent nearly a decade building a career in finance. He held progressively senior roles, most recently serving as Financial Reporting Manager at a publicly traded company in the cannabis industry. In this role, Andrew led a team responsible for complex financial reporting and regulatory compliance across multiple jurisdictions. His experience in a highly regulated industry sparked an interest in the intersection of law and business, particularly in how legal frameworks shape businesses and emerging industries. This ultimately led him to pursue a career in law. Outside of work, Andrew enjoys travelling, taking vocal lessons, learning Ukrainian and exploring local trails with his golden retriever.
